Before the highly anticipated clash, Arsenal held a slender lead over Manchester City in the Premier League title race, setting the stage for a pivotal encounter at the Emirates Stadium. The Manchester City Arsenal match ultimately saw Pep Guardiola's side secure a dominant 3-1 victory, a result that significantly shifts the momentum in the championship pursuit. This win, marked by goals from Kevin De Bruyne, Jack Grealish, and Erling Haaland, underscored City's clinical efficiency and tactical superiority during the crucial second half.
Key Moments and Tactical Shifts
The first half was a tense affair, with Kevin De Bruyne capitalizing on a defensive error to put City ahead in the 24th minute. Arsenal responded just before halftime with a Bukayo Saka penalty, leveling the score and reigniting hopes. However, the second half saw a distinct shift in control. Manchester City intensified their pressure, leading to Jack Grealish's go-ahead goal in the 72nd minute, followed by Erling Haaland's decisive strike in the 82nd minute, sealing the 3-1 win.
Impact on the Premier League Title Race
This outcome has profound implications for the Premier League title race. Manchester City's victory not only propelled them to the top of the league standings but also delivered a psychological blow to Arsenal. The Gunners now face the challenge of regrouping and maintaining their composure as the season progresses. The analytical breakdown of the Manchester City Arsenal match highlights City's ability to perform under pressure and convert opportunities.
- Final Score: Arsenal 1-3 Manchester City
- Goal Scorers: De Bruyne (MC), Saka (ARS, pen), Grealish (MC), Haaland (MC)
- Venue: Emirates Stadium
- Significance: Major shift in Premier League title race
